January 24 | Senator Sheldon Whitehouse (D-RI), Chairman of the Senate Judiciary Courts Subcommittee, delivers the twenty-seventh in a series of speeches titled “The Scheme,” exposing the machinations by right-wing donor interests to capture the Supreme Court and achieve through the Court what they cannot through the elected branches of government.
Whitehouse discusses Loper Bright Enterprises v. Raimondo, a case pending before the Supreme Court that could overturn Chevron deference. That doctrine, a cornerstone of administrative law for nearly 40 years, grants agencies the flexibility they need to issue regulations that protect Americans’ health and safety. Whitehouse details how Loper is the product of a larger, decades-long effort by pro-corporate interests to eviscerate the federal government’s regulatory apparatus, to the detriment of the American people.
